大型网站常见的缓存形式包括内存缓存、数据库缓存和分布式缓存。

1. 内存缓存:内存缓存是将数据存储在内存中,以提高数据的访问速度。常见的内存缓存工具包括Redis和Memcached,它们可以将频繁访问的数据缓存在内存中,减少对数据库的访问次数,提高网站的响应速度。

2. 数据库缓存:数据库缓存是将数据库查询结果缓存起来,减少对数据库的频繁查询。通过使用数据库缓存,网站可以减少数据库的负载,提高数据的读取速度。常见的数据库缓存工具包括MySQL的查询缓存和PostgreSQL的查询缓存。

3. 分布式缓存:分布式缓存是将缓存数据分布在多台服务器上,以提高缓存的容量和性能。常见的分布式缓存工具包括Redis Cluster和Memcached集群,它们可以将数据分布在多台服务器上,实现负载均衡和高可用性。

通过使用这些缓存形式,大型网站可以提高数据的访问速度和系统的性能,提升用户体验。